KATHMANDU: The Cricket Association of Nepal (CAN) has announced the Nepali squad for the upcoming ICC Men’s Cricket World Cup League 2 and the Nepal-Canada bilateral series.

The Nepal-Canada bilateral series is scheduled to commence from February 8 to February 12, followed by the ICC Men’s CWC League 2, set to kick off from February 15 to February 24.

For the bilateral series, the selected Nepali players include Rohit Poudel, Aasif Sheikh, Kushal Bhurtel, Dev Khanal, Kushal Malla, Bhim Sharki, Aarif Sheikh, Pawan Saraf, Sompal Kami, Hemant Dhami, Rijan Dhakal, Surya Tamang, Lalit Rajbanshi, Aakash Chand, and Anil Sah.

Meanwhile, the squad for the ICC Men’s CWC League 2 comprises Rohit Poudel, Aasif Sheikh, Kushal Bhurtel, Kushal Malla, Aarif Sheikh, Pawan Sharaf, Bhim Sharki, Arjun Saud, Dipendra Airee, Gulshan Jha, Sompal Kami, Karan KC, Lalit Rajbanshi, Surya Tamang, and Rijan Dhakal.

Additionally, players Pratish GC, Dev Khanal, Anil Shah, and Bibek Yadav have been named as reserves for the ICC games.
